Quick Assessment

This middle-grade fantasy follows King Edwin, also known as King Flashypants, as he embarks on a brave quest to defeat a threatening creature called the Voolith. Suitable for readers aged 9 to 12, the story combines elements of adventure and humor while exploring themes of bravery and generosity. There is mild peril appropriate for the age group, with no intense violence or mature content.

Why we rated King Flashypants and the creature from Crong 11LP

King Flashypants and the creature from Crong is written at a Level 6 reading level across 205 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 7.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, King Flashypants and the creature from Crong works for readers up to grade 8.0.

We rate King Flashypants and the creature from Crong as 11LP ("Light — Physical")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, King Flashypants and the creature from Crong explores adventure, humor, family, generosity, and kings and rulers —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
